First, if you have one available swap out the toner cartridge. It is possible on this series for the toner cartridge to cause double imaging. This is especially true if the double imaging is across the entire page. If the double imaging is in more of a streak or line down the page especially on one edge then is it more likely to be a fuser film going bad. You can replace the fusing unit yourself if you want. Just do a google search for HP 4350 fuser unit (going by the picture in your post)
About $150 to $200
If you can find a guy, you can have just the fuser film replaced in your fuser unit at a cost of around $175 for parts and labor.
The most expensive route is to have a service company replace the fuser. They will charge you around $300 parts and labor.
